Alex Goodman
ad1a72c6ff
ignore prerelease verions when uploading version file on release
2020-07-29 14:54:47 -04:00
Alex Goodman
06f8355fce
finalize update check URL
2020-07-27 15:13:41 -04:00
Alex Goodman
d21de64cb3
use mount path for version upload
2020-07-27 09:35:55 -04:00
Alex Goodman
6536f0bb36
upload version check file on release
2020-07-27 09:30:05 -04:00
Alex Goodman
78c3652759
bump bouncer version
2020-07-25 16:55:41 -04:00
Alex Goodman
2502814143
rollup static analysis to make target
2020-07-25 16:40:37 -04:00
Alex Goodman
05c78de9d3
generate java fixtures ahead of tests
2020-07-25 10:06:52 -04:00
Alex Goodman
c9dea59232
verify signing fingerprint
2020-07-25 09:59:48 -04:00
Alex Goodman
1ba0678cf6
provide signed checksums
2020-07-25 08:42:50 -04:00
Alex Goodman
32bd57886e
add publish release
2020-07-25 07:09:20 -04:00
Alex Goodman
14ec30aee1
fix acceptance test compare script & persist
2020-07-24 17:41:22 -04:00
Alex Goodman
0a0bc68e95
show verbose test output to prevent circleci kills
2020-07-23 21:47:11 -04:00
Alex Goodman
a4016d35ce
rename to syft
2020-07-23 20:54:04 -04:00
Alex Goodman
2132700198
add apk/alpine support ( #98 )
2020-07-23 20:35:57 -04:00
Alex Goodman
5ccd6d5f6a
check for unsupported "go get" chars ( #100 )
2020-07-23 13:08:31 -04:00
Alex Goodman
ba4f63099d
Add release process ( #89 )
...
* add check for app update; fix ETUI error handling
* validate user args
* add goreleaser support
* replace cgo dependencies (go-rpm) with go equivalents
* add acceptance tests against build snapshot
* add brew tap + acceptance test pipeline
* add mac acceptance tests
* fix compare makefile
* fix mac acceptance tests
* add release pipeline with wait checks
* add token to release step
* rm dir presenters int test
* enforce dpkg to be non interactive
Co-authored-by: Alfredo Deza <adeza@anchore.com>
* pin brew formulae
* pin skopeo to formulae url
* only run acceptance tests
Co-authored-by: Alfredo Deza <adeza@anchore.com>
2020-07-23 10:52:44 -04:00
Alex Goodman
9e285fd0e2
use common entry point for integration tests; refactor cmd pkg ( #86 )
2020-07-17 15:16:33 -04:00
Alfredo Deza
b734623ef0
make: bump test coverage
...
Signed-off-by: Alfredo Deza <adeza@anchore.com>
2020-07-17 13:32:53 -04:00
Alfredo Deza
b457d4ebd2
tests: drop coverage requirement to 69% for now
...
Signed-off-by: Alfredo Deza <adeza@anchore.com>
2020-07-15 10:15:58 -04:00
Alex Goodman
e8d11eec69
add license validation ( #80 )
2020-07-13 13:07:20 -04:00
Alex Goodman
61f51d80bb
Add comparative analysis with anchore-engine ( #78 )
...
* add comparative analysis
* remove extra comma from compare script tuple
Co-authored-by: Alfredo Deza <adeza@anchore.com>
Co-authored-by: Alfredo Deza <adeza@anchore.com>
2020-07-13 12:12:00 -04:00
Alex Goodman
3f090f9647
fix java cache key for CI; fix circle docker api version ( #79 )
2020-07-13 12:11:11 -04:00
Alex Goodman
e55db9247e
add java cataloger
2020-07-08 16:16:01 -04:00
Alex Goodman
1896831c39
add rpmdb support; enhance integration tests
2020-07-06 12:55:11 -04:00
Alex Goodman
d59a19697d
add coverage + makefile improvements
2020-07-06 07:25:18 -04:00
Alex Goodman
2471663d27
sync/fmt linting tasks with stereoscope
2020-05-21 09:37:20 -04:00
Alex Goodman
cb6555491c
add analyzer interface/controller and supporting package/catalog
2020-05-13 10:13:48 -04:00
Alex Goodman
1e5c7bb5c7
initial project structure
2020-05-12 10:45:18 -04:00